Output 945d96aec107fcc7c5393c7a7ebbf9cf7e2a20468c88c5a9211821f15635f42a:0

value
2043840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d51228e4dc96e11d6839b3585c6b8c989700e2d OP_EQUAL
address
3Bf2moyiSVH9qvj83aXbjEuzr6BeN2m4Nu
transaction
945d96aec107fcc7c5393c7a7ebbf9cf7e2a20468c88c5a9211821f15635f42a
spent
true